## Changelog — API key rotation

Welcome aboard! Quick context: our public REST API (Larkspur) uses cursor-based pagination, and cursors are signed so clients can't forge them. We rotate the cursor-signing key quarterly; old cursors stay valid for 24 hours after rotation. This entry marks this quarter's rotation — nothing else changed. For local testing, the current signing key is right below.

signing key of yajog-kafof = bky19_orbYRY3Abj3KpZesMie

Quick steps for hammering the Pellwick checkout flow before the seasonal push. Spin up the synthetic cart generator with the medium profile first — don't jump straight to peak, the payment stub gets grumpy. Watch the p95 on the confirm-order endpoint; anything over 900ms means the inventory lock is contending. If you see timeouts, scale the worker pool before blaming the database, it's almost never the database. Log your run in the shared sheet and tag the load harness build you used, shown below.

session token of kageg-tahop = htk14_af3c1ccccb7dcf

Runbook: Fernpost digest batches

Heads up, release manager: the digest scheduler won't pick up new batch windows until you bounce the worker pool, so plan for a two-minute gap around 02:00. Update DIGEST_WINDOWS in the Fernpost env file to match the new regional schedule, and double-check the timezone is set to the Calverton default. The scheduler also signs each batch manifest, and that signing key lives right in the same env file. Drop the key in on the following line.

sealed setting: ARCHIVE_KEY3=8d0